Abstract

国家层面的灌溉区域统计数据集的不一致可能对制定粮食和水安全政策产生重大影响。遥感可以解决这个问题;然而,对其可靠性的怀疑限制了其主导作用。基于遥感和统计数据集集成的方法似乎是权宜之计,但它们更可能被决策者认可。因此, 了解源于国家层面的统计数据集的基础及其局限性于科学家而言极其重要。。通过综述七个亚洲国家(中国,印度,巴基斯坦,孟加拉国,尼泊尔,印度尼西亚和泰国)的灌溉区域数据收集方法,本文指出了造成数据不确定性的因素以及数据收集方法的局限性。为了了解灌溉区域的空间分布格局与统计记录中不确定性之间的关系,本文还进行了灌溉密度分布分析。结果发现,灌溉面积统计数据主要基于水用户协会和农民的信息,而这些信息是自主报告,或是调查和普查时访谈收集到的。出现差异的主要原因有:缺乏经常列举灌溉土地的资源、数据收集方法不一致、次要作物未加说明、非法和无节制的利用水以及官僚主义和政治限制等。灌溉密度分布分析表明,分散的灌溉区域可能容易缺乏全面性而频繁的枚举。此外,密集灌溉地区可能存在潜在的未记录灌溉区域,且该区域少数农民进行了临时或补充灌溉安排。
